This episode is a Mahasoma team effort as we come together to answer your questions. We get a lot of inquiry on social media, emails, and group meditations, so we thought podcast episodes would be a great way to share more. We will be exploring your questions, sharing our real life experiences, and tapping into relevant themes/happenings we’re going through as a collective. In this episode we hope to give you some insight into who we are, how we came to meditation, and how the Vedic wisdom can be applied to your everyday life right now.
What we talk about in this episode:

  • How we came to meditation and what it has given us
  • The concept of time - past, present and future – where do they exist?
  • Who is telling your story?
  • Upgrading our memories to experience immediate liberation

Mahasoma is a feminine-led meditation collective sharing Vedic wisdom and practices to support you in becoming more grounded, present, and creative. Our teachers are Laura Poole, Sarah O’Brien, and Kathleen O’Brien. We teach in-person courses in Melbourne, Castlemaine, Surf Coast, Noosa, Albury, Adelaide, Northern Rivers, Sydney, and travel to teach around the world.
